Default Shadow effect tutorial

Hi girls,
Some asked me how I did my shadow effect in the middle of this card:
Gallery at Splitcoaststampers

It's a technique I've learned 2 weeks ago, it's called Versamard Resist (with Kaleidoscope pad)
1. Stamp you image in versamark on glossy paper.
2. Wait until it's dry..................
3. Take a brayer and roll it in a Kaleidoscope. Be aware to not blend all colors.
4. Roll your inked brayer on your glossy paper. The Versamark image will resist.
5. Take a Kleenex to take off the excess of ink.

That's it! Easy and a big effect!!!!!!!
